Can a person run an oringed primary chain so you don't have to run oil in the primary case ? If it's good enough to run the wheel why not the primary? The reason for my thought is I can't get the oil leak from one of the three bigger Allen bolts to quit leaking . I cleaned threads in case really good and dried, put some "right stuff" gasket maker on threads . Thinly coated the two gaskets and spacer up from behind the primary cover backing plate , tightened down then put oil in . Leaks every time . That bolt hole in the crank case is suppose to go all the way through to the inner correct ?

G'day 427.
You could but I wouldn't advise it. The primary runs a lot faster than the rear drive chain to start with. The O ring chain will sap a lot more power to run and the sprockets will wear a lot faster. More costly and harder to get than rear sprockets.
Try fitting fiber washers under the screw heads.

Can a person run an oringed primary chain so you don't have to run oil in the primary case ?
Friend of mine tried running without oil in the primary case, everything in there got extremely hot (too hot), racers do it but then they cut holes in the cover to allow cooling air to pass through.
No the oil in there lubricates and cools, both of equal importance

Hi 427,
I wouldn't advise running with the chain case dry, because the clutch bearing needs a little bit of oil now and then to stop it seizing up. I used to have oil weeping from that Allen bolt so I fitted a small O ring on it and now its leak free. Just use a little Vaseline or silicone grease to allow it to go in without it snarling up. As regards chain case oil I did a measure of the oil capacity needed to touch the bottom of the primary chain. A after fitting the outer chain case I found I needed 310cc of oil to just touch the bottom of the chain, that's with a totally dry chain case. If you are just doing an oil change it only needs 190cc of oil and do not over fill it as the bearing only needs a splash of oil now and then. I only use motorcycle engine oil 10-40 Castrol as it doesn't contain additives that make the clutch slip. SRM also recommend this and not ATF. Hope this helps, and yes the Allen bolt does go all the way into the crankcase but make sure its not too long as it will foul on the Crank.

Primary covers take a beating over the years .
Over tightening the screws causes the hole to collapse which makes maters worse.
Then there are the morons who will put allen headed cap screws into the primary that have only 1/2 the surface area under the head and that makes matters even worse.
It does not stop the leak so they do them up till it does or they strip out the thread whichever comes first.
It is worth while to get either a counter bore or end mill and square off the contact face.
Find some washers that are a good close fit to the outer edges of the hole then tighten them finger tight + 1/4 turn, no more.
One of the bolts is the drain and it needs a sealing washer of some kind and O rings do an excellent job, if they have something vaguely flat to seal against.
As for the O ring primary, as already stated, not a good idea.
